Alle Bilder auf einem Laufwerk skalieren

Akki

Mitglied
Registriert
19.02.09
Beiträge
19
Ort
A-Steiermark
Hallo, Ich habe schon zwei Tage im Forum gestöbert, komme jetzt aber nicht mehr weiter.
Ich betreue einen Server mit ca 100 Clients. (Baufirma)
Jetzt kann ich meine Daten nicht mehr vernünftig Sichern.
Ich möchte alle Bilder(jpg) auf einem Laufwerk in der Größe ändern. (max 1400 - proportional zum Original).
Die Originale sollen dabei überschrieben werden.
Die Bilder sind eigentlich nur zur Beweissicherung gespeichert - und diese Auflösung ist ausreichend.
Die Mitarbeiter davon zu überzeugen, dass sie Ihre Kameras nicht mit 10 MP oder mehr betreiben ist leider fehlgeschlagen...
Ich habe schon mit dem Skript Path2Virtual experimentiert, und habe auch keine Probleme eine virtuelle Bilderliste zu erstellen.
Nur da habe ich jetzt 390.000 Bilder drinnen, und die möchte ich alle verkleinern. (Aber am original Speicherplatz und die Originale löschen)
Geht das ???
Bitte helft mir

Akki
 
AW: Alle Bilder auf einem Laufwerk skalieren

Das würde ich "am lebenden Patienten" eher nicht machen.

Frank
 
AW: Alle Bilder auf einem Laufwerk skalieren

Das ist nicht so kritisch...
gibt jeden Tag eine Bandsicherung - momentan noch, aber gerade da stoße ich an meine Grenzen. Denn diese Laufwerke und Bänder kosten wirklich Geld - Festplattenplatz ist ja kein Thema.
 
AW: Alle Bilder auf einem Laufwerk skalieren

Hallo!

Problem ist, daß die Stapelverarbeitung nur ein Verzeichnis abarbeitet und nicht rekursiv alle Unterverzeichnisse davon. Es gibt aber diverse Skripte, die einen rekursiven Algorithmus enthalten, also machbar ist es.

Gruß,

Ralf
 
AW: Alle Bilder auf einem Laufwerk skalieren

Mit Faststone Imageviewer (freeware) geht es (selbst probiert).
Use advanced option > size.
Markiere: Tools > Batch convert/rename > Batch Convert Tab > use folder structure in output folder.

Gruß,

Kees
 
AW: Alle Bilder auf einem Laufwerk skalieren

Zum Testen von Verkleinerungen dieses Bild auf 640x400 verkleinern (und auch wieder als PNG speichern!), dann die Kreiskante betrachten.
Zum Vergleich FixFoto's eigenen Algorithmus verwenden.
 
AW: Alle Bilder auf einem Laufwerk skalieren

Da ich ein ähnliches Problem habe, werde ich dafür ein Skript erstellen. Das Grundgerüst steht schon.

ScaleAll.gif

Jetzt werde ich allerdings erst einmal Karneval feiern.
 
AW: Alle Bilder auf einem Laufwerk skalieren

Ich finde es Klasse, das Mecki14 sich an ein solches Skript "macht". Ich werde Deinen Fortschritt mit Interesse verfolgen. :)

Vor einigen Monaten hatte ich eine sehr ähnliche Aufgabenstellenung
In 3 verschiedenen Verzeichnisbäumen mit vielen Unterverzeichnissen sollten alle TIF- und PSD-Fotos (keine JPGs) auf Full-HD Format verkleinert werden, wobei der Name der verkleinerten Datei auf 4TV erweitert werden sollte und der Speicherort im Originalordner liegen sollte.
Mit FF hatte ich das nicht hinbekommen, aber mein DAM-Programm - IDImager pro - hat die Aufgabe fehlerlos gemeistert, auch wenn es für die reichlich 8000 Fotos fast die ganze Nacht "gerödelt" hat ;D.
Nur ob das Überschreiben der Originale auch möglich ist weiß ich nicht, im meinem Fall wollte ich das ja absolut nicht.

LG Frank
 
AW: Alle Bilder auf einem Laufwerk skalieren

Hallo!

Ich habe auch regelmäßig Bilder in verschiedenen Verzeichnissen gleichzeitig zu skalieren, so daß mir das Skript sicher zu mehr Effizienz verhelfen wird.

Gruß,

Ralf
 
AW: Alle Bilder auf einem Laufwerk skalieren


Ich habe den Vorschlag von ingobohn ausprobiert: <Datei><Batchkonvertierung><Spezial-Optionen aktiv><Setzen>

Geht wunderbar, man kann auch in die Quell-Verzeichnisse konvertieren.

Aber man muss sich für ein Ziel-Dateiformat entscheiden - Quell-Dateiformat beibehalten geht nicht.
Und bei mir läuft es nur im Administratormodus (WinXPHome SP3), vom Benutzer mit eingeschränkten Rechten gestartet, rödelt es zwar, aber es gibt kein Ergebnis.
 
AW: Alle Bilder auf einem Laufwerk skalieren

Ich bin auf ein neues Problem bei der Sache gestoßen...
Ich muss das Skript oder den Patch auf Digitalkamera Bilder beschränken.
Es gibt - sehr verstreut - auch ander Grafikdateien welche ich nicht umwandeln sollte.
Habe ein wenig am Server gestöbert, kann eigentlich die ganze Operation auf .jpg einschränken.
Alle anderen sollen unberührt bleiben.

Habe nicht geglaubt, dass das so schwierig wird...

Gruß Akki
 
AW: Alle Bilder auf einem Laufwerk skalieren

[...] kann eigentlich die ganze Operation auf .jpg einschränken.
Alle anderen sollen unberührt bleiben.

Quellformat kannst du einstellen bei der Batchkonvertierung in IrfanView.

NB: Ich will hier keine Reklame gegen FixFoto und für IrfanView machen, es schien mir nur so, dass du dringendst eine Lösung brauchst.
 

Anhänge

  • 2009-02-22_235114_ff.webp
    2009-02-22_235114_ff.webp
    24,2 KB · Aufrufe: 479
AW: Alle Bilder auf einem Laufwerk skalieren

Die Betaversion meines Skript ScaleAll ist fertig. Ich stelle es hier vor.

Ich bin auf ein neues Problem bei der Sache gestoßen...
Ich muss das Skript oder den Patch auf Digitalkamera Bilder beschränken.
Es gibt - sehr verstreut - auch ander Grafikdateien welche ich nicht umwandeln sollte.
Habe ein wenig am Server gestöbert, kann eigentlich die ganze Operation auf .jpg einschränken.

Hallo Akki,
die Filterung bestimmter Dateitypen habe ich für die nächste Version bereits geplant.
 
AW: Alle Bilder auf einem Laufwerk skalieren

Tut mir leid, war jetzt ein paar Tage offline - Schnee - Lawinensperren und so.
Wohne da mitten drinnen.
Danke erst mal an alle.
Werde mir jetzt das Skript von Mecki14 holen und testen

lg aus der verschneiten Obersteiermark

AKKI
 
Zurück
Oben